What is Off-Page SEO?
Off-page SEO, in essence, refers to all the activities that occur outside your website but have a direct impact on its search engine performance. It primarily involves building a strong online presence, increasing your website’s authority, and establishing your website as a reputable source of information in your niche.
1. Backlinks: The Off-Page SEO Foundation
Backlinks, or inbound links from other websites to yours, are an important component of off-page SEO. Search engines like Google regard these links as a vote of confidence in the credibility of your website. The more high-quality, relevant websites that link to your content, the more Google will regard your site as an authoritative authority in your sector. This not only improves your ranks but also the reputation of your website.
2. Social signals are important.
Another important aspect of off-page SEO is social media presence. While social signals are not directly used by search engines as ranking factors, they might have an indirect impact on your ranks. Sharing your material on social media can boost its visibility, resulting in additional traffic and more backlinks. A strong social media presence can also help to develop your brand’s authority and credibility, both of which are important considerations for search engines.
3. Management of Online Reviews and Reputation
Off-page SEO requires you to manage your internet reputation. Positive online reviews on platforms such as Google My Business, Yelp, and others not only boost your online credibility, but also have an impact on your local SEO rankings. Encourage satisfied customers to submit reviews and respond to any negative feedback to demonstrate your commitment to customer satisfaction, which can improve your rankings.
4. Guest blogging and content marketing
Off-page SEO relies heavily on the creation of good, shareable content. You may establish yourself as an expert and acquire significant backlinks by producing insightful articles, blog posts, and infographics on respected websites in your sector. This strategy not only increases the visibility of your website but also positions you as a thought leader in your sector.
